Ceiling on Desires

 

" Who is the poorest man?

 

He who has much desires is the poorest man in the world.

 

Who is the richest man?

 

He who has much satisfaction is the richest man in the world " .

 

Baba

 

What is the meaning of " Ceiling on Desires " ?

 

Man is deluded by his unlimited desires. He is living in a dream world. He is

forgetting the Supreme Consciousness (Paratattwa). That is why it is important

to keep our desires under control, to place a ceiling on them. We are spending

too much money. Instead of inordinately spending for our own pleasure, we should

be spending for the relief of the poor and needy. This is the real meaning of

Ceiling on Desires. Do not make the mistake of thinking that giving money is all

that is needed, however. Do not give to others while allowing your own desires

to continue to multiply. Curtail your desires, as materialistic desires lead to

a restless and disastrous life. Desires are a prison. Man can be freed only by

limiting his wants. You should have desire only for life's bare necessities.

 

How can you reduce the desires ?

 

Food is God-Do not waste food.

 

Firstly,consider the food we consume. Eat only what you need to eat. Do not be

greedy. Do not take more than you can eat and waste the rest, because wasting

food is a great sin. The surplus food can feed another stomach. Do not waste

food, because food is God, life is God, and man is born from food. Food is the

main source of man's life, body, mind and character. The gross part of the food,

which is the major portion of the food consumed by the body, is thrown out as

waste matter. A minute amount of the food, which is the subtle part, is

assimilated by the body and flows as blood. And a minuscule amount, which is the

subtlest part of the food, makes up the mind. Therefore, the mind is the

reflection of the food consumed. The reason for the present beastly and demonic

tendencies in our minds is the food we consume.

 

A large part of the water we drink is expelled as urine. A minute part of the

water consumed becomes the life force (prana). Therefore, the nature of the food

and water that we take in decides our character. Only by controlling the quality

of our food and water can we attain Divinity. This is why food is said to be

God. Hence, to waste food is to waste God. Do not waste food. Eat only what you

need, and be sure that what you eat is Sathwic. Give any surplus food to those

in need.

 

Misuse of money is Evil.

 

Secondly, consider the ways in which money is spent. Indians consider money or

wealth as the Goddess Lakshmi. Do not misuse money. By doing so you will only

become a slave to bad qualities, bad ideas, and bad habits. Use your money

wisely for good deeds. Do not waste money, as misuse of money is evil. It will

lead you along the wrong path.

 

Time wasted is Life wasted

 

Thirdly, examine the usage of time. The most important, the most needed factor,

is time. One should not waste time. Time should be spent in a useful manner.

Time should be sanctified because everything in this creation is dependent on

time. Even our scriptures say that God is referred to as Time and Beyond Time.

 

The main reason for man's birth and death is time. Time is the main factor in

our growth. Time wasted is life wasted. Therefore, time is an essential part of

our life. Do not degrade time by spending it participating in unnecessary

conversations, or by getting involved in other's personal matters. The truth

behind the saying " Don't waste time " is that no time should be wasted in evil

thoughts and acts. Instead, make use of time in an efficient way.

 

Do no Evil-Do what is Good

 

Fourthly, conservation of energy is very important. Our physical, mental, and

spiritual energies should never be wasted. You might ask me: " How are we

wasting our energies? " Seeing bad things, hearing bad things, speaking evil,

thinking evil thoughts, and doing evil deeds all waste your energy. Conserve

your energy in all these five areas, and make your life more meaningful.

 

See no evil - see what is good.

Hear no evil - hear what is good.

Speak no evil - speak what is good.

Think no evil - think what is good.

Do no evil - do what is good.

This is the way to God.
